Seven Tunisians arrested on dinghy heading to Italy

Suspects apprehended in El Hoauria on Cap Bon peninsula

 The Tunisian authorities on Monday arrested seven Tunisian nationals for trying to make the illegal sea crossing to Italy, the interior ministry has said.

The suspects were apprehended on board a dinghy in El Hoauria on the Cap Bon peninsula.

One of the suspects was reportedly wanted by police. The suspects said they had paid approximately 500 Tunisian dinars (less than 250 euros) per head for the failed crossing.
